I appreciate all the advise on transporting my bronco to Colorado. It all worked out well; used a 16 foot Penske and an auto transport. The tire straps fit well over the 32" tires and I used two additional straps on the front and rear. This was in addition to the chain safety for each axle. The weather was a challenge throughout, wind, afternoon heavy thunderstorms, hail and some crazy drivers, but it all added to the adventure.
